The University of Toronto Varsity Blues football team dropped a 43-7 decision to the Queen's Gaels on Saturday, September 8 at Richardson Stadium in Kingston, Ont.
TORONTO STATS:
Third-year quarterback Clay Sequeira went 13-for-28 for 141 yards, while also leading the Blues with nine rushes for 67 yards on the day. Sequeira's favourite target was sophomore Will Corby, who hauled in five catches for 74 yards.
Fourth-year defensive back Jordan Gillespie notched a career and game-high 10 tackles, while veteran linebacker Lamar Foyle had seven tackles and third-year defensive lineman Malcolm Campbell added five tackles and two sacks in the loss.
BLUES HIGHLIGHT:
Second-year defensive back Caleb Zigby got the Blues on the board late in the third quarter, picking off Gaels QB Nate Hobbs and returning the ball 62 yards to the end zone.
